The 2009 independent psychological thriller short film , directed by David J. Negron Jr., is officially available to watch on major streaming networks including Amazon Prime Video . Written by Mo Abersheid, this eerie, character-driven piece runs deep into the human psyche, following three daughters and their father as they live in a secluded retreat.
Cursed Opportunities (2009) is a niche psychological short. For fans of slow-burn psychological thrillers, it serves as an interesting exploration of a dysfunctional, secluded household, though its specific, intense focus may not be for all viewers.

Let’s be honest: this is a 2009 short film shot on what appears to be a MiniDV camcorder. Do not expect 4K. The version you find for free will likely be between 240p and 480p. The lighting is murky, the sound mixing is rough, and the acting ranges from "community theater intense" to genuinely unnerving.
